Treen is our regular holiday destination, we love the place and visit about 4 times a year. We camp in the summer but use the beautiful Gwennel Barn for our winter stay. The owners, Nico and Peter rescued the barn from near ruin, it wasn’t that long ago it had no roof and the walls were about to cave in. But under their care it has undergone a marvellous restoration and has now become a luxury holiday let. It is so lovely to return to such a cozy barn after a day of exploring the amazing beaches and glorious coastal paths, with its luxurious underfloor heating. We haven’t stayed in the summer but imagine it’s just as lovely to return home at the end of a hot day and fling the doors open. I have no hesitation whatsoever in recommending this beautiful spotless accomodation, it has been carefully equipped with everything you will need for your stay. So much to do in the area: the beaches (Pednvounder, Porthchapel and Portheras Cove) must be amongst the most beautiful in the world, white sand and turquoise water - the amazing open air Minack Theatre - the surfing paradise of Sennen Cove - St Michaels Mount and nearby Marazion - and would highly recommend a trip out on the Marine Discovery catamaran from Penzance, very likely to see dolphins! There is loads to do! Get yourself to the area, and if you want luxury for a very reasonable price, this is the place to stay!
